The formula to calculate the first n square numbers is displayed below:

   
n(n + 1) × (2(n) + 1)
 
   
6
 

To calculate the sum of the first 2937 square numbers, we enter n = 2937 into our formula to get this:

   
2937(2937 + 1) × (2(2937) + 1)
 
   
6
 

First, calculate each section of the numerator: 2937(2937 + 1) equals 8628906 and (2(2937) + 1) equals 5875. Therefore, the problem above becomes this:

   
8628906 × 5875
 
   
6
 

Next, we calculate 8628906 times 5875 which equals 50694822750. Now our problem looks like this:

   
50694822750
 
   
6
 

Finally, divide the numerator by the denominator to get our answer:

50694822750 ÷ 6 = 8449137125

There you go. The sum of the first 2937 square numbers is 8449137125.
